1 in 2 of marriages deal with chronic illness, and most of them are invisible (ie: depression, diabetes, ). Kimberly shares what life is like when you’re dealing with constant challenge in your body. She has an incredible heart and really gives us wisdom whether we’re serving a chronically ill spouse or receiving their care. Spoiler alert: There is so much hope in this episode.

You’ll Discover:
- How to do marriage when you have chronic illness
- How illness affects marriage and how it often (75%) ends in divorce
- How people respond to stress differently and how vital this is
- How Jesus shines through the way we handle the most difficult things in our marriages
- Thoughts on chronic illness and physical intimacy
